AI Contract Overview
The contract requires identification, documentation, and labeling of hazardous materials used in cable assemblies to comply with OSHA Hazard Communication standards and DFARS regulations, ensuring all chemical substances are properly classified and labeled according to federal safety guidelines. This includes adherence to specific exemptions under the Federal Insecticide, Fungicide, and Rodenticide Act and the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act, where applicable, to avoid unnecessary or redundant labeling for exempted components. All materials must be thoroughly documented with accurate safety data and clearly marked to ensure safe handling, storage, and use throughout the supply chain. Performance is required at Hill Air Force Base with a zip code of 84056-5734, and the subcontract falls under NAICS code 541690, indicating professional, scientific, and technical services related to other scientific and technical consulting. The solicitation was posted on July 30, 2026, with a response deadline of August 10, 2026, and is managed by the Department of Defense under the Land Supply Chain organization. Compliance is mandatory to meet federal defense procurement standards and ensure operational safety and regulatory alignment across all contracted cable assembly components.
